“Dolphin Tale” is a 2011 family drama film directed by Charles Martin Smith that follows a lonely 11-year-old Sawyer Nelson and an injured dolphin named Winter. He spots a young dolphin on the shore after she gets stuck in a crab trap. Although she is immediately taken to a naval hospital, her tail is severely damaged and almost impossible to save.
Now Winter needs a miracle if she wants to get back in the water and swim again. Fortunately for her, a marine biologist, a prosthetics designer and her devoted friend Sawyer come to her rescue and make the impossible possible. Where Was Dolphin Tale Movie Filmed?
“Dolphin Tale” was filmed entirely in Florida, particularly in Pinellas County. Principal photography for the dolphin-based film reportedly began in September 2010 and ended after three months in December of that year.
The real Winter, who plays herself on screen, lived in Florida, so the crew decided to shoot the film on location to bring more authenticity to the narrative.
Florida
All key sequences for ‘Dolphin Tale’ were shot in Pinellas County, located on the west central coast of Florida. The production crew was primarily camped at the Clearwater Marine Aquarium at 249 Windward Passage in Clearwater, where Winter lived.
The Long Center at 1501 N Belcher Road in Clearwater also served as a prominent manufacturing location. Meanwhile, the beach scenes were seemingly filmed at Fort De Soto Park at 3500 Pinellas Bayway South in Tierra Verde.

During the shoot, the cast and crew were seen shooting several important scenes on the premises of two different institutions. They are Admiral Farragut Academy – Preparatory School & International Boarding School at 501 Park Street North and Pinellas Technical College at 901 34th Street South, both in St. Petersburg. Additionally, some interior scenes were recorded at the Bay News 9 studio at 700 Carillon Parkway #9 in St. Petersburg.

The crew used locations in the town of Tarpon Springs, Satin Leaf Avenue in Oldsmar, and Honeymoon Island State Park at 1 Causeway Boulevard in Dunedin to film the rest of ‘Dolphin Tale.
In addition to this dolphin-based film, Pinellas County served as an important filming location for many other productions such as The Punisher, ‘Spring Breakers, ‘Six Dance Lessons in Six Weeks’ and ‘Waiting on Mary.
